Climbing stairs
Psychological (Freud)
Depth psychology reads climbing stairs as an image of inner ascent: ambition, the drive to advance and the wish to reach a higher rung of the self. In the classical view the rhythmic up-and-down of the steps is also a veiled expression of bodily arousal and unlived desire.
Oriental reading
In Oriental-Islamic dream interpretation, climbing a staircase with ease is a favourable omen of rising in rank, standing and faith. To stumble or fall, however, warns of a setback or of a pride that may bring one low.
